How to fill out the E-CDRweb User Guide Secondary Authorized Official - EPA online

This comprehensive guide will assist you in completing the E-CDRweb User Guide as a Secondary Authorized Official for the EPA. Follow the step-by-step instructions to navigate the form and ensure your submissions are accurate and complete.

Follow the steps to effectively complete the form.

  1. Press the 'Get Form' button to acquire the form and access it in your editor.
  2. After obtaining the form, log into the e-CDRweb tool using your CDX account credentials.
  3. Navigate to the 'Home' screen by selecting 'Chemical Data Reporting (CDR)' from the drop-down menu.
  4. Select 'User Management' to assign any Supports that will help complete the form.
  5. Click on the 'Forms' link to access the '2012 CDR Form U' screen where you can create or edit the form.
  6. To start a new submission, click on the 'Secondary Form' with a status of 'Not Started' and create a passphrase.
  7. After entering your passphrase, you will be directed to the 'Secondary Company Information' screen.
  8. Use the 'Validate' icon to check for errors throughout the filling process.
  9. Once all fields are correctly filled, click the 'Submit' icon to initiate the submission process.
  10. After submission, you can download a Copy of Record for your records, and if needed, create an amendment through your previously submitted form.

The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) protects people and the environment from significant health risks, sponsors and conducts research, and develops and enforces environmental regulations.

EPA works to ensure that: Americans have clean air, land and water; National efforts to reduce environmental risks are based on the best available scientific information; Federal laws protecting human health and the environment are administered and enforced fairly, effectively and as Congress intended;

The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) is responsible for the protection of human health and the environment.

Since the EPA's founding in 1970, concentrations of common air pollutants, like sulfur dioxide, have dropped as much as 67 percent. The EPA helped mitigate catastrophes like acid rain, leaded gasoline, and DDT.

The EPA regulates the manufacturing, processing, distribution, and use of chemicals and other pollutants. Also, the EPA is charged with determining safe tolerance levels for chemicals and other pollutants in food, animal feed, and water. The EPA enforces its findings through fines, sanctions, and other procedures.
